Latest Patents

Masako Iizuka is credited with a noteworthy patent titled "Method of Manufacturing Semiconductor Devices." This innovation focuses on producing semiconductor devices with small diameter via-holes, specifically not exceeding 0.6 microns, for multilayer interconnections. Her patented method involves covering an interlayer film and via-holes with a continuous first metal film through a chemical vapor deposition (CVD) process. Following this, she utilizes an energy beam to heat and melt a second metal film deposited on the first one using a physical vapor deposition (PVD) process. This method allows for the effective filling of the via-holes, consequently forming conductive plugs that enhance the functionality of semiconductor devices. Moreover, the deposition of the second metal film and filling of the via-holes can be conducted simultaneously using a high-temperature sputtering process.
